当前位置: 首页 > 知识库问答 >
问题:

React Components的导入语句在ES6中的工作原理[重复]

赫连靖琪
2023-03-14

PropType 封装在 React 源代码的 React 对象中,所以这个语句是如何工作的——

从“react”导入{PropTypes};

共有1个答案

司马奇希
2023-03-14

模块可以将部分代码导出为默认和命名导出。

例如,react库可能有这样的内容

// named export
export function PropTypes(){/*....*/}
// defaul export
export default function(){/*....*/}

因此,在导入时,我们可以简单地导入默认导出

import React from 'module';

要导入命名导出,我们应该使用大括号

从'模块'导入{PropTypes};

简单地说,我们合并上面的代码行

import React, { PropTypes } from 'module'

在此处阅读有关模块的更多信息

 类似资料:
  • 当我们创建准备语句对象时,它是否缓存在服务器端?与Oracle驱动程序中的准备语句相比有何不同?如果重用准备语句,哪些数据将发送到Cassandra服务器,仅限参数值? 据我所知,java驱动程序中的一个会话对象持有到集群中多个节点的多个连接。如果我们在多个线程中重用应用程序中相同的准备语句,会使我们只使用一个连接到一个Cassandra吗?我猜准备语句只在一个连接上完成...当路由键被每个执行调

  • 我有3个不同的TS文件,在1个主TS文件中动态加载2个TS文件,如下所示 现在,在这两个TS文件中,我正在导入jquery和jquery父TS文件 我的tsconfig.json 所以我的问题是jquery文件加载3次还是只加载一次。

  • 问题内容: 我有这个要求声明 但我想将其编写为es6 import语句 我努力了 和 但是无法使其正常工作,那么导入这样的软件包的正确方法是什么? 问题答案: 您将分为两部分,首先是导入,然后是函数调用: 如果它本身是一个已命名的导出 , 并且不关心调用它是什么: 为了完整起见,在确认以上内容之前,我还列出了其他可能对将来的其他人有用的其他可能性: 如果是 默认 导出(而不是其自己的命名导出)的属

  • 本文向大家介绍工作中常用到的ES6语法,包括了工作中常用到的ES6语法的使用技巧和注意事项,需要的朋友参考一下 什么是ES6?   ECMAScript 6(以下简称ES6)是JavaScript语言的下一代标准,已经在2015年6月正式发布了。Mozilla公司将在这个标准的基础上,推出JavaScript 2.0。   ECMAScript和JavaScript到底是什么关系?很多初学者会感到

  • 一、mitmproxy的工作原理 Mitmproxy是一种非常灵活的工具。准确了解代理过程的工作原理将有助于您创造性地部署代理,并考虑其基本假设以及如何解决这些假设。本文档详细介绍了mitmproxy的代理机制,从最简单的未加密显式代理开始,到最复杂的交互操作-在存在服务器名称指示的情况下,对受TLS保护的流量进行透明的代理。 二、显式HTTP 配置客户端以使用mitmproxy作为显式代理是拦截

  • 问题内容: 想知道。排序导入语句的正确方法是哪种?还有哪个更具可读性? 喜欢, 外部类(如),然后是内部包 类。 只是按字母顺序 提前致谢。 问题答案: 从Java编程风格指南中 import语句必须在package语句之后。import语句应首先使用最基本的软件包进行排序,并与相关的软件包分组在一起,并且各组之间应留空行。 ..... ..... 导入语句的位置由Java语言强制执行。通过排序,

  • 问题内容: 什么是相对进口?在python2中还允许在其他什么地方导入star?请举例说明。 问题答案: 每当导入相对于当前脚本/软件包的软件包时,就会进行相对导入。 例如,考虑以下树: 现在,你derived.py需要从中获得一些东西。在Python 2中,你可以这样做(在中): Python 3不再支持该功能,因为它是否明确要求“相对”还是“绝对” base。换句话说,如果base系统中安装了

  • 问题内容: 我认为将import语句放在靠近使用它的片段的位置,可以通过使其依赖项更加清晰来提高可读性。Python会缓存吗?我应该在乎吗?这是一个坏主意吗? 还有一点理由:这是针对使用库中奥秘功能的方法的,但是当我将方法重构为另一个文件时,我没有意识到我会错过外部依赖项,直到遇到运行时错误。 问题答案: 其他答案似乎对真正的工作方式略有困惑。 这个说法: 大致等效于以下语句: 也就是说,它将在当